The cheapest way to get from Riihimäki to Vaasa is to train which costs €40 - €70 and takes 3h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Riihimäki to Vaasa is to train which takes 3h 25m and costs €40 - €70.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Riihimäki and arriving at Vaasa.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3h 25m.
The distance between Riihimäki and Vaasa is 346 km. The road distance is 352 km.
The best way to get from Riihimäki to Vaasa without a car is to train which takes 3h 25m and costs €40 - €70.
The train from Riihimäki to Vaasa takes 3h 25m including transfers and departs once daily.
Riihimäki to Vaasa train services, operated by Finnish Railways (VR), depart from Riihimäki station.
Riihimäki to Vaasa train services, operated by Finnish Railways (VR), arrive at Vaasa station.
Yes, the driving distance between Riihimäki to Vaasa is 352 km. It takes approximately 4h 14m to drive from Riihimäki to Vaasa.
